The Canadian government has taken another step to block the passage of immigrants. The Trudeau government has drastically increased the fees from December 1 for all those who want to reach here, including international students immigration.
This decision is being considered as a big blow for Punjabis and with this decision, their dream of studying and living abroad may be broken. Experts believe that due to increase in application fees, processing fees may also double. The application fees that the Government of Canada has announced to increase include student, visitor visa, temporary residence, new study permit, work permit, etc. However, there is no guarantee that these categories can get a visa.
In fact, from December 1, there will be an increase in application and processing fees for visitors, workers and students coming to Canada. This will have the greatest impact on those people of Punjab, who are studying or working in an organization in Canada. The Department of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ship (IRCC) in Canada has increased the fees for many applications for temporary residents.
It is worth noting that the federal government recently significantly reduced the number of permanent residents entering Canada over the next two years and tightened the rules on temporary worker permits. Statistics provided by Canadian authorities show that the average wait time for refugee and asylum claims to be processed is about 44 months.
Immigration Minister Mark Miller, appearing before a parliamentary committee, said the asylum system was not working properly and had to be completely overhauled. The Immigration and Refugee Board had more than 260,000 asylum claims under consideration by the end of October, and the number is still rising.
